Why does the dosage of Selegiline hydrochloride tablets (Selegiline) need to be reduced when combined with levodopa?
Selegiline hydrochloride tablets (Selegiline) can enhance the efficacy of levodopa, but may exacerbate its side effects, such as involuntary movements, nausea, hallucinations, etc. When used in combination, the dose of levodopa needs to be reduced by approximately 30% to balance efficacy and safety. Clinical studies have shown that selegiline can prolong the action time of levodopa and reduce the "end-of-dose phenomenon", but blood pressure, heart rate and mental symptoms need to be closely monitored. If serious side effects occur, stop taking the medicine immediately and seek medical advice. It should be noted that the dosage of levodopa must be adjusted under the guidance of a doctor to avoid increasing or decreasing it on your own.
